Jared Goff and fiancée Christen Harper have a lot to celebrate.
The Lions quarterback and the Sports Illustrated Swimsuit model attended the launch of the iconic publication’s 60th anniversary issue at the Hard Rock Hotel in New York on Thursday — days after Goff agreed to a four-year contract extension with Detroit worth up to $212 million.

The model engrained herself in the Detroit community when Goff was traded to the Lions in January 2021 in a blockbuster exchange with the Rams for Matthew Stafford.
The Lions went 12-5 and won the NFC North last season en route to the NFC Championship game, which they lost to the 49ers, 34-31.
Prior to that, Goff led the Lions to their first playoff win in 32 years, a 24-23 triumph over Stafford and the Rams in the wild-card game.
